Definition Essay Rubric Introduction effectively catches the attention of the reader and leads into a strong thesis. 4 3 2 1 0 Thesis states term to be defined and briefly states how a High School student views the meaning of “Survival”. 4 3 2 1 0 Examples includes several quotes that are explained, and clearly illuminate the meaning of the term. 4 3 2 1 0 Examples paragraphs are developed with enough detail to show how they relate to the thesis. 3 2 1 0 4 Examples paragraphs are arranged in a logical order that aids understanding. 4 3 2 1 0 Examples all relate to how a High School student views the word. Essay includes strong transitions that help the paper flow from one point to another. 4 3 2 1 0 4 3 2 1 0 Conclusion ends the essay without introducing new questions or ideas and is an effective ending/ summation of the paper as a whole 4 3 2 1 0 Essay adheres to the basic rules of grammar, spelling, and punctuation Student avoids use of contractions 4 3 2 1 0 4 3 2 1 0 Total _____/40 40=100 Definition Essay Rubric Introduction effectively catches the attention of the reader and leads into a strong thesis. 4 3 2 1 0 Thesis states term to be defined and briefly states how a High School student views the meaning of “Survival”. 4 3 2 1 0 Examples includes several quotes that are explained, and clearly illuminate the meaning of the term. 4 3 2 1 0 Examples paragraphs are developed with enough detail to show how they relate to the thesis. 3 2 1 0 4 Examples paragraphs are arranged in a logical order that aids understanding. 4 3 2 1 0 Examples all relate to how a High School student views the word.
